
立创ESP32S3功能拓展底板
简介
立创开发板ESP32-S3-R8N8功能拓展板
简介:立创开发板ESP32-S3-R8N8功能拓展板开源协议
:CC BY-SA 3.0
(未经作者授权,禁止转载)描述
一、项目背景
立创开发板部门在前不久发布了ESP32-S3-R8N8系列开发板,性能也是非常强悍,做工也是相当精致,但是却一直没有一款功能拓展板供大家入门和学习。
遇到这种情形,身为 资深的ESP32开发者 的我必须要站出来缓解这一尴尬的局面
二、提出设想
设计一款功能拓展板,要求可以像学习51单片机那样学习ESP32那就必须具备51单片机开发板的几个必备模块:
一、独立按键
二、LED灯
三、数码管
四、电位器采集
五、舵机驱动
六、温湿度采集
七、OLED 屏幕显示
八、光照强度采集
九、超声波雷达测距
十、433.92Mhz射频通信(进阶)
ESP32最具代表性的功能当然不能少了那就是WiFi蓝牙通信
以上十多个项目的学习,大家就可以学习到以下知识点:
GPIO的输入(独立按键)
GPIO的输出(LED)
数码管的静态显示,动态扫描
模数转换
定时器输出PWM
通过OLED 屏幕的驱动和温湿度数据的采集可以学习单总线和双总线的通信机制
超声波可以学习到定时器PWM的输出和脉冲的捕获
通过日志打印可以学习串口数据的收发
EEPROM数据存储
文件系统的建立
普通蓝牙、低功耗蓝牙的使用、Webserver内网服务的建立、WiFi的STA-AP模式的使用。
大家可以直接点击进入立创商城购买开发板点我前往立创商城
三、固件刷写及日志调试
点击跳转_在线固件刷写工具
为了极大的降低大家的入门门槛,我把烧录工具都免了,做到了【无需下载安装,支持跨系统】的完全基于浏览器的在线固件刷写工具
点击跳转_在线串口调试工具
在线固件刷写搞了,不搞个在线串口工具肯定说不过去,所以我也做到了【无需下载安装,支持跨系统】的完全基于浏览器的在线串口调试工具
TIPS:要从KEY4切换到其他功能需长按对应按键5秒
四、实物展示(彩色丝印是真的好看)
实拍图
正面仿真图
背面仿真图
五、手机APP蓝牙通信
点灯科技APP可前往点灯科技官网下载
操作前先完整复制此配置文件到手机剪贴板
{¨version¨¨2.0.0¨¨config¨{¨headerColor¨¨transparent¨¨headerStyle¨¨dark¨¨background¨{¨img¨¨assets/img/bg/4.jpg¨}}¨dashboard¨|{¨type¨¨num¨¨t0¨¨湿度¨¨ico¨¨fad fa-humidity¨¨clr¨¨#076EEF¨¨min¨É¨max¨¢1Ie¨uni¨´℃´¨bg¨É¨cols¨Í¨rows¨Ë¨key¨¨HUMI_Data¨´x´Í´y´Î¨lstyle¨Ê}{ßBßCßD¨温度¨ßF¨fad fa-sun¨ßH¨#00A90C¨ßJÉßK¢1cßL´℃´ßMÉßNÍßOËßP¨TEMP_Data¨´x´É´y´ÎßRÊ}{ßBßCßD¨超声波测距¨ßF¨fad fa-cctv¨ßH¨#FBA613¨ßJÉßKº1ßL¨厘米¨ßMÉßNÍßOËßP¨CSB_Data1¨´x´É´y´ÑßRÊ}{ßBßCßDßWßFßXßH¨#6010E4¨ßJÉßKº1ßL¨英尺¨ßMÉßNÍßOËßP¨CSB_Data2¨´x´Í´y´ÑßRÊ}{ßBßCßD¨光照强度¨ßF¨fad fa-lightbulb-on¨ßH¨#EA0909¨ßJÉßKº1ßL´%´ßMÉßNÍßOËßP¨Light_Data¨´x´Ë´y´ËßRÊ}{ßB¨deb¨¨mode¨ÉßMÉßNÑßOÌßP¨debug¨´x´É´y´¤B}÷¨actions¨|÷¨triggers¨|÷¨rt¨|÷}
复制完成后再开始下面的操作
第一步、添加蓝牙设备
第二步、绑定开发板
第三步、更新界面配置
大功告成!
手机APP的数据是在对应的模式更新对应的数据,不是全部实时更新
六、用户服务协议
功能类别说明:
该项目主线功能旨在为用户更为方便的学习和使用立创开发板ESP32-S3-R8N8。
在复刻本项目前请认真阅读本协议:
只要您下载或复刻了《立创ESP32S3功能拓展底板》(后简称为:本项目)就代表您已经仔细阅读并完全同意本协议。凡以任何形式使用本项目(直接或间接使用)均被视为自愿完全接受相关声明和用户服务协议的约束。
除非本项目的作者与当事人相互以书面的形式做出相反约定,且在相关法律所允许的最大范围内,否则作者按其现状提供本作品,对本作品不作任何明示或者默示,包括但不限于任何有关可否商业性使用、是否符合特定的目的、不具有潜在的或者其他缺陷、准确性或者不存在不论能否被发现的错误的担保。有些司法管辖区不允许排除前述默示保证,因此这些排除性规定并不一定完全适用于您。
用户明确并同意其使用本项目所存在的风险及法律风险将完全由其本人承担;因其使用本项目而产生的一切后果也由其本人承担,本项目作者及立创开源硬件平台对此不承担任何责任。
除非书面同意,否则在任何情况下,本作者及立创开源硬件平台均不对您承担赔偿责任,包括任何一般的,特殊的。
您在传播、使用及修改本作品时,应自行保证您的一切行为与本作品的全部功能符合一切对您有管辖权的法律法规的要求,由您传播、使用本作品而产生的法律风险及造成的后果,将由您自行承担,项目作者及立创开源硬件平台不承担任何责任。
未经授权 禁止将本项目直接或间接的用于商业目的。
本项目最终解释权和知识产权归 南京倾宁云控科技有限公司 所有。
七、总结
这个项目陆陆续续进行了1个多月,主要是平时太忙了只能抽出零碎的时间进行开发和调试。
但整体效果我自认为还是非常可以的,对得起这一个月的付出。
我PCB板画的比较业余,还望各位大佬轻点骂。
八、致谢
战略合作伙伴:南京倾宁云控科技有限公司
一、感谢嘉立创EDA专业版提供PCB设计支持。
二、感谢凌承芯电子(蜂鸟无线)提供射频模块耗材支持。
三。感谢点灯科技(成都)有限责任公司提供手机APP的使用支持
感谢各位观众老爷们看到这里!喜欢这个项目就赶紧通过嘉立创的免费打样一起玩起来吧!
我是小涵,欢迎评论,转发!喜欢我的频道不妨帮忙点个关注!我们下个项目见!
点我加入QQ交流群
群号:873075959
转载请找作者申请 无过分要求均会同意 转载后请注明出处并附加工程链接:
https://oshwhub.com/xiaohanxdzdy/li-chuang-development-board-esp32s3-r8n8-function-expansion-backplane
固件版本更新日志(一直在马不停蹄的开发中)
最新版本:G1.24.01
版本号:G1.24.01
上线日期:2024年5月20日
更新内容:
项目正式开源
目前支持:LED显示、按键检测、温湿度采集、光照采集、数码管显示、OLED 屏幕显示、电位器采集,舵机驱动、串口数据收发。
目前不支持:WiFi、蓝牙、射频通信。
设计图

BOM


评论